The first bottleneck in most government sales pipelines is the founder.

April 28, 2026 | Business Development

Not the schedule. Not the buyer. Not the proposal.

You.

We’ve seen it for 20 years. The founder is researching, writing, calling, teaming, and quoting. 

The pipeline grows until the founder runs out of hours, then it freezes.

Time is finite. 24 Hours in a Day 365 Days in a Year. You can’t create more.

Pick one thing this week that is not yours anymore. Hand it off, even imperfectly.

MYTH: I just need one big contract to change everything.

FACT: Sustainable government sales are built on pipeline depth, disciplined prospecting, and repeatable process. Companies that depend on “one big win” usually stall when that win does not come.
